CC253X系统中闪存控制器寄存器详解与static_timing_analysis
需积分: 42 9 浏览量
更新于2024-08-10
收藏 8.99MB PDF 举报
本篇文档主要介绍了闪存控制器的寄存器在6.5章节中的详细内容,它属于针对2.4GHz IEEE 802.15.4和ZigBee应用的CC253X片上系统解决方案的用户指南。文档首先概述了CC253X系统的关键组件,包括CPU(如8051 CPU)、内存、时钟和电源管理、外设以及无线功能。8051 CPU的详细介绍涵盖了其结构、存储器映射、寄存器(如数据指针、R0-R7寄存器、程序状态字、累加器、B寄存器和堆栈指针)及其功能。
在CPU寄存器部分,文档重点阐述了它们的作用和操作,如数据指针用于指示内存地址,R0-R7作为基本的数据暂存单元,程序状态字用于记录当前执行状态,累加器用于算术和逻辑运算,B寄存器作为辅助寄存器,而堆栈指针则管理程序调用时的堆栈操作。文档还讨论了8051 CPU的指令集和中断管理,包括中断屏蔽、处理流程和优先级设置。
此外,文档还涉及了调试接口,包括调试模式、数据传输、调试命令、锁位机制、硬件断点设置以及与闪存编程相关的操作。电源管理和时钟管理是关键环节,讨论了不同的工作模式(如主动和空闲模式),以及如何通过电源管理寄存器来控制电源状态。振荡器和系统时钟的配置也被详细讲解,包括32kHz振荡器和相应的寄存器。
最后,闪存控制器是文档的核心部分,介绍了闪存存储器的组织结构,以及写入操作等相关技术。这部分内容对于理解和优化闪存控制器的性能和管理至关重要。
总体来说,这篇文档为用户提供了一个深入理解CC253X系统中闪存控制器寄存器操作和管理的全面指南,适用于开发人员进行系统设计和故障排查。
2020-11-12 上传
2021-03-30 上传
2023-06-08 上传
2023-06-02 上传
2023-06-02 上传
2023-07-28 上传
2023-07-09 上传
2023-06-10 上传
2023-05-26 上传
黎小葱
- 粉丝: 23
- 资源: 4032
最新资源
- C++标准程序库:权威指南
- Java解惑:奇数判断误区与改进方法
- C++编程必读:20种设计模式详解与实战
- LM3S8962微控制器数据手册
- 51单片机C语言实战教程:从入门到精通
- Spring3.0权威指南:JavaEE6实战
- Win32多线程程序设计详解
- Lucene2.9.1开发全攻略:从环境配置到索引创建
- 内存虚拟硬盘技术:提升电脑速度的秘密武器
- Java操作数据库:保存与显示图片到数据库及页面
- ISO14001:2004环境管理体系要求详解
- ShopExV4.8二次开发详解
- 企业形象与产品推广一站式网站建设技术方案揭秘
- Shopex二次开发:触发器与控制器重定向技术详解
- FPGA开发实战指南:创新设计与进阶技巧
- ShopExV4.8二次开发入门:解决升级问题与功能扩展